Step-by-Step Deletion Process

Once you’re ready to proceed, follow these steps for a seamless account deletion:

  • Login to Your Account: Use your credentials to access your Fundrise account dashboard.
  • Navigate to Account Settings: Locate the “Account” or “Settings” section, often found in the top right menu or dropdown.
  • Review Your Investments: Confirm all your investments are settled, and no pending transactions are in progress. This may involve waiting for any open transfers to close.
  • Contact Support: Fundrise often requires users to initiate account deletion through customer support. Look for the “Help” or “Contact Us” link where you can engage with their support team via chat or email.
  • Confirm Deletion: Once you have made your request, follow any additional instructions provided by the support team to verify your identity and confirm your account deletion request.

Ensuring that this process is done correctly can save you from future headaches, so always double-check that you’ve taken the appropriate steps before finalizing your decision.

Impacts of Account Deletion on Your Investments

When you decide to delete your Fundrise account, it’s important to understand the potential impacts on your investments. The decision to part ways with this investment platform involves more than just a click of a button; it entails a series of financial ramifications that could affect your overall portfolio strategy.

To begin with, deleting your Fundrise account will lead to the liquidation of any investment holdings you have within the platform. Fundrise primarily focuses on real estate investments through a crowdfunding model, which often involves long-term commitments. If you remove your account, you may have to sell your shares, which can impact your overall returns, especially if market conditions are not favorable at the time of liquidation. You might miss out on future gains if the properties appreciate or if dividend payments increase after your departure.

Moreover, consider the tax implications associated with selling your investments. If you have held shares in Fundrise for less than one year, any gains from the sale will typically be subject to short-term capital gains tax, which is generally higher than long-term rates. This is a crucial factor to account for, as it could significantly reduce your actual returns upon withdrawal. Therefore, consulting a financial advisor might be beneficial to fully understand any potential tax burdens you may face.
